Structure

We have established the Safety and Health Committee to deliberate on important matters regarding safety and health, with the aim of preventing employee accidents (disasters) and diseases, and promoting health. With the General Safety and Health Manager as the chairperson and the Personnel Dept. acting as the secretariat, the committee consists of occupational physicians, safety managers, health managers, and employees including employee representatives, and meets once a month to discuss and promote initiatives regarding safety and health. Minutes are disclosed on the internal intranet as needed to ensure awareness and education for all employees.
In the unlikely event of occupational injuries (labor accidents), the Safety and Health Committee is structured to consider measures to prevent recurrence. In addition, we regularly report to the Board of Directors on specific measures and progress regarding health promotion, such as the implementation status of health checkups, as well as issues, and receive supervision.

Compensation Structure

We determine wages by linking three systems: the job group system which defines the roles and responsibilities required of employees, the evaluation system which evaluates performance based on behavior and results, and the compensation structure which stipulates the composition of remuneration and how evaluations are reflected. Under the remuneration system, in addition to monthly salaries, wages are paid to employees as bonuses, in principle twice a year.
In addition to complying with the laws and regulations of the countries and regions where we conduct business, we ensure wage levels that exceed statutory minimum wages and thoroughly implement equal pay for equal work. We have introduced fair and appropriate evaluation and remuneration systems based on job content, roles, the magnitude of responsibilities, and performance.

Dialogue with Employees

We have introduced an employee representative system to seek the opinions of employee representatives when creating or changing labor-management agreements or work regulations. At each business site, employee representatives are selected through voting or recommendation by employees to conclude agreements and work regulations, and to provide opinions. Employee representatives serve as members of the Safety and Health Committee and deliberate on important matters regarding safety and health.

Prevention of Overwork and Working Hours Management

We comply with laws and regulations of the countries and regions where we conduct business activities, regarding labor, and prevent excessive long working hours through the appropriate tracking and management of working hours. Regarding employee working hours, in addition to declarations made through the attendance management system, we manage time using objective data such as PC logs, and have established a system to check and correct any discrepancies between the two.
Regarding overtime and holiday work, based on the Labor Standards Act, we conclude agreements regarding overtime and holiday work at each location and notify the relevant Labor Standards Inspection Office. We manage overtime work within the limits stipulated by laws and regulations, ensuring appropriate operation even in cases of temporary special circumstances.
Furthermore, from the perspective of health maintenance, for those confirmed to have exceeded a certain amount of overtime, we provide guidance such as interviews by occupational physicians. The status of these matters is regularly reported at the Safety and Health Committee, allowing us to systematically grasp the occurrence of long working hours.

Working for Health and Productivity Management

The Health and Productivity Management Declaration and Promotion Structure

We established the Hanwa Health and Productivity Management Declaration on April 1, 2018. The president was designated the Chief Health Officer (CHO), and the Health and Productivity Management Office was set up in the Personnel Department.
In FY2022, we introduced a three major illness compensation system to help employees balance treatment and work. In April 2023, the organization was reorganized into the Health and Productivity Management Section to further promote health management. We were recognized as a Health & Productivity Management Outstanding Organization 2024 (large enterprise category) in March 2024. We will continue to promote measures to promote the creation of an environment where all employees can continue to be healthy, both physically and mentally, and play an active role.
